Heres the deal, I had a coolant leak so i replaced the Lower intake manifold gasket. During reassembly, I had a dumb a** moment where i read the torque specs wrong and tried to tighten the intake manifold to 35 Ft lbs..... I figured id keep my fingers crossed. Now I see an oil leak occurring. Should I dig in and try to replace the gasket again with the right specs or look towards something else?

you may have have squeezed all the sealant out of the back side of the lower intake when you over tightened it...i am guessing you then backed the bolts out to proper torque and created a gap....just my guess.

but hard to tell till you take a look....if it wasnt there before i would say its safe to say recent activity may be connected to it.
